Synopsis

This story subverts the traditional "chasing wife crematorium" trope common in romance fiction. Instead of enduring the typical cycle of regret and desperate pursuit, the protagonist, Zhou Yanze, decides to abandon the chase entirely and seek a new partner. It reads like a satirical commentary on angst-heavy BL tropes, mirroring the energy of short-form anti-cliché web-fiction. This novel is ideal for readers who enjoy quick, trope-flipping narratives and snarky protagonists who refuse to play the victim. Conversely, those seeking a slow-burn romance, intricate world-building, or a detailed plot should skip this entry. Because of its extreme brevity, the pacing is lightning-fast, focusing on a singular subversive punchline rather than traditional character growth. Its standout quality is the refreshing refusal to adhere to expected genre beats, providing a brisk and unconventional reading experience.

Editorial Review

6.3/10
Story6
Pacing8
Characters5
Value6

As an editor, it is difficult to judge this as a full novel given that it consists of only six chapters. It functions more as a vignette or a conceptual sketch than a complete narrative. The primary strength lies in its subversive premise; by rejecting the chasing wife crematorium cycle, the author provides a quick, satisfying twist for those tired of repetitive romance beats. However, the brevity is also its greatest weakness. With such a low chapter count, there is no room for genuine emotional stakes or character development, leaving the story feeling more like a joke than a developed plot. While the completed status ensures a conclusion, the lack of substance makes it a disposable read. It serves as a curious curiosity for genre enthusiasts but lacks the weight required for a higher recommendation.
